The Long Answer: It's Cold, People!

Maine's coastline is undeniably beautiful. The rocky shores, the lighthouses, the smell of salt in the air - it’s all very picturesque. But when it comes to the water temperature, let's just say it's more like a polar bear's plunge than a tropical vacation.

Tips for Surviving a Maine Ocean Swim

If you're determined to take the plunge, here are a few tips:

  • Acclimate Gradually: Start by dipping your feet in. Once you've convinced yourself you can handle it, gradually go deeper.
  • Wetsuit Up: If you really want to enjoy the experience, invest in a wetsuit. It makes a world of difference.
  • Bring a Hot Beverage: Nothing warms you up like a hot chocolate or coffee after a cold swim.
